🐞 Bugs That Have Been Squashed
🐞Fixed: API Calls Reduced [API] The V1.GetAutoOrders and V1.GetAutoOrder were being called in excess and creating a number of issues. We stopped calling CalculateOrder, cached the tax information, and reduced the number of API calls to Avalara being made by the system.
🐞Fixed: iPayout Error Recognition [Corporate Admin] There were orders getting marked PAID in Corp Admin when the associated payment had failed on the iPayout side. Now when a payment fails, it will not be marked as PAID, and the Admin should see the failed payment. When there is a successful payment, the payment will be marked as PAID and will be shown as such in Corp Admin.
